Who is a nephrologist?
A nephrologist is a kidney doctor specializing in the diagnosis, treatment, and management of kidney diseases. They are experts in renal health.
Can a nephrologist treat a urinary tract infection?
Nephrologists specialize in kidney disease. While they can manage a urinary tract infection (UTI) that has affected the kidneys, a general physician is typically better suited to treat uncomplicated UTIs.
